Step 03

  • Now we will have to make that image blend with the background that we have created.
  • Duplicate the layer and go to image >Adjustments >Black and White and give tint as the color and save it.
  • And again duplicate it and make it black and white.
  • Now keep the tint layer on top of the black and white layer and blend it to soft light.
  • Now resize the head a bit to fit in to the canvas.

Step 05

  • Now select all the barbed wire brush layers and duplicate them and merge them and keep that layer below the screaming man’s head layer.
  • Then apply a Gaussian bluer around 13px. The result is like below.

Step 10

  • Now for the final touches, we will add some more detail to the background.
  • So we will use two more textures to add more grungy look to the Background. We will use the texture back grounds called (check the “Resources” section at the beginning)
    • grunge-texture-powerpoint-backgrounds and paint-4background 
  • first add the paint 4 background on top of the main grungy ash color background that we used in the first step of the tutorial
  • Then blend it to Overlay and reduce the opacity to 75% and then use the second texture on top of it and blend it in to multiply.
